Transaction fcbf50b28a3a12cdc4e126672d8debe69a2732f55d4b8d709e27cdbae463ffac
1 Input
1 Output
-
fcbf50b28a3a12cdc4e126672d8debe69a2732f55d4b8d709e27cdbae463ffac:0
- value
- 15299990
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c6d324304af9ac679a5a4c00e5f558b86fed907
- address
- bc1q33knyscy47dvv7d95nqquh643wr0akg89m52an